Moroccan Chicken

This chicken recipe is quick and tastes very different from most things I make.  I like the combination of flavors because the prunes make it sweet, but not too sweet. It is a great meal to use up leftover chicken. My husband doesn’t like couscous, so I serve it over rice, even though couscous would be more Moroccan.

Moroccan Chicken Recipe

Published By Anne
Prep Time10 minutes
Cook Time20 minutes
Total Time30 minutes
Servings: 4
Print Save Rate Pin

Ingredients
 

  • 2 Tablespoon oil
  • 1 onion sliced
  • 1 1/2 cups cooked chicken
  • 1 can tomatoes diced
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 8 prunes diced
  • 1/4 teaspoon allspice
  • 1/2 teaspoon tumeric
  • 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 cup parsley

Instructions

  • Heat oil in skillet and add onions. Brown for 5 minutes.
    2 Tablespoon oil, 1 onion
  • Add all the remaining ingredients except parsley. Cover and cook for 5 minutes over medium heat.
    1 1/2 cups cooked chicken, 1 can tomatoes, 1/2 cup water, 8 prunes, 1/4 teaspoon allspice, 1/2 teaspoon tumeric, 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on, 1 teaspoon salt
  • Uncover and simmer for another 10 minutes until the dish is nice and thick. Top with parsley and serve over rice or couscous.
    1/4 cup parsley
